Hi all,

I have read some conflicting post about whether I could keep honey gouramis and neon tetras together. I have 10 neons, one bn plec, 4 otocinculus and want to add 2 - 3 honey gouramis. The tank is well planted and properly cycled. Anyone see an issue with this?

Well first it would be nice to know your tank size and its measurements.
 
Yes, they should be able to share a tank. If it’s big enough, that is. My 55 gallon community tank has neons and honey gourami.
 
Not a problem. What do you call a honey Gourami. Latin name please. IF they are Colisa Chuna not a problem.
 
Well first it would be nice to know your tank size and its measurements.
Oh sorry I thought I said! Juwel 120L lido fairly heavy on the plants.
61 x 58 x 41 cm
Substrate - Japanese baked soil (columbo)
Ph 6.6
0 ammonia
0 nitrites
5 - 10 ppm nitrates
